str8acura: Thanks, Yeah, I would like to paint the mud guards, but as you can see I had the mud guards painted on my White Coupe and its starting to wear away. I have been told there is no guarantee how long painted mud guards will last.
FZ427: I like them.. The ride is a bit stiffer, but not much and it took care of most of the gap. I think it will settle a little more within in a couple of weeks.
